Sad news Donald Sutherland dead at 88: Star of M*A*S*H and The Hunger Games passing announced by actor son Kiefer

Hollywood has lost one of its iconic figures as Donald Sutherland, renowned for his roles in “MASH” and “The Hunger Games,” passed away at the age of 88. The news was confirmed by his son, actor Kiefer Sutherland, who expressed profound sorrow over the loss of his father. Donald Sutherland’s illustrious career spanned over five decades, earning him critical acclaim and a place in the hearts of audiences worldwide.

Sutherland’s versatility as an actor allowed him to portray a wide range of characters, from the rebellious Hawkeye Pierce in “MASH” to the chilling President Snow in “The Hunger Games” series. His performances were marked by a distinctive blend of intensity and charm, making each of his roles memorable. Beyond his on-screen achievements, Sutherland was admired for his dedication to his craft and his ability to continuously reinvent himself, remaining relevant in an ever-changing industry.
